JAAA is the cheaper of the two at 0.20% a year

As of September 11, 2026, JAAA charges 0.20% a year and holds $30.8B in assets.

As of September 11, 2026, TQQQ charges 0.97% a year, yields 0.64% and holds $35.8B in assets.

What moved TQQQ this week

TQQQ fell 1.5% in the week to September 11, 2026. The holdings that moved it most were Nvidia (−4.4%), Microsoft (−2.8%) and Palantir Technologies (−8.4%); Advanced Micro Devices (+13.1%) pushed the other way.
